Leadership Overview
The Hagerman Group has 6 executives leading key functions including operations, finance, human resources, and overall company direction.
Driven by a legacy of construction excellence, The Hagerman Group is dedicated to delivering comprehensive construction solutions, upholding a philosophy of integrity and client-focused project execution across Indiana.
